Mitch (Evangelist)

Mitch is a Christian communicator and co-founder of Crown Jesus Ministries. Having served over sixteen years with the Northern Ireland Fire and Rescue Service, he stepped in full-time ministry in 2011. A popular speaker and author. His energy, wit, honesty and passion allow him to communicate in a relevant way to today’s society.

Mitch is the author of ‘Snatched from the Fire’ (IVP). He also writes for two leading Christian magazines in Ireland, is on the board of Rejoice Always, a SCORE Chaplin, member of Fire Fighters for Christ, regional rep for More than Gold and an associate of J. John and Philo Trust. He is married to Amanda and they have two children, eight fish (at last count), two chickens and a dog! He is a massive Chelsea F.C. supporter who loves curries, cycling and lazy days in France

Philip Kerr (Evangelist)

Philip is one of the co-founding evangelists of Crown Jesus Ministries. He was the first full-time member of staff with the organisation and is well respected for his solid biblical teaching and balanced theology. He is determined in his preaching to prove again and again that the gospel is true and relevant today. Philip’s warm character and love for people make him hugely popular as a public speaker and a real asset to the ministry. He is passionate about coming alongside churches to establish lasting evangelistic works that connect with communities. Outside of preaching Philip looks after much of the management side of Crown Jesus and co-ordinates the ‘If my people...’ prayer events.

Philip is married to Rachel and they have two children, Grace and Reuben. He supports Arsenal F.C. and loves Indian grub!

Steven Halliday (Youth and Schools Co-ordinator)

Steven also known as ‘Stee’ graduated from Queens University, Belfast with a Bachelor of Divinity in 2003. His depth of biblical knowledge, quick wit and creativity make him unique among youth workers. Stee has become well respected across many schools and denominations for his ability to communicate with sincerity and love. He has a passion to reach young people with the gospel and continues to inspire many of the youth of today into a deeper relationship with Jesus as he heads up the 1-Way Youth Department for Crown Jesus.

Stee is married to Carey. They have a dog called Chloe and a horse called Riley. He loves all sports especially football and snooker and also enjoys playing the drums.

Sharon Pedlow (Office Administrator)

Sharon joined the Crown Jesus team in 2003. She exercises her gifts in administration as she manages the busy office and helps out in many different practical ways. Sharon also has tremendous gifts of discernment and intercession that have proved crucial in the decision making process of the ministry. She has a passion for overseas mission and is a member of Covenant Love Church.

Sharon is married to Ian and they have two children, Johnny and Rachel and two grandchildren, Joshua and Lucas. She is a brilliant cook with wonderful gifts of hospitality and makes some of the best tray bakes in Northern Ireland!

David Murphy (Youth Co-ordinator)

David is the Co-ordinator of the Crown Jesus youth initiative HUB and also works alongside Stee on Camp Ireland. He is passionate about seeing a generation of young people rise up in God to take a stand in their faith and impact their community for Jesus. Using his qualifications in youth work as well as his degree in advertising/communication, he is always on the lookout for new and creative ways to share the message of Jesus. Living in a media and social networking culture Dee believes the message of Jesus does not need to change, simply the method in which we share it! David also helps with the Klass Kids work of Crown Jesus and is often found hiding behind a puppet theatre making kids laugh and teachers blush!

David is married to Karen and they live in Comber but he still maintains he is an ‘East Belfast Boy’ at heart!

Richard Kernohan (Childrens Work Co-ordinator)

Richard has been working with Crown Jesus since 2007 and in 2011 moved to a full-time role. He uses all his creativity, attention to detail and infectious personality to head up the Klass Kids department of Crown Jesus. This works goes into schools across the province and impacts many thousands of children each year by taking assemblies, R.E. classes, S.U. meetings and after school events. Richard is also line manager to the five gap year students in the office and regularly uses them in Klass Kids events.

Rick is an active member of Green Pastures Ballymena and hates watching football (but is surprisingly good at it if you can drag him onto the pitch!).
